Question
you have just sliced raw roast beef on the meat slicer. now you are going to use the machine to slice some cheese. this is an example of:
possible answers:
a) cross - contamination
b) poor personal hygiene
c) time - temperature abuse
d) all of the above
Cross-contamination occurs when harmful substances or pathogens transfer from one food/object to another. Using the same meat slicer for raw beef (a potential source of pathogens) then cheese without cleaning transfers contaminants from beef to cheese, fitting this definition. Poor personal hygiene relates to individual cleanliness, and time-temperature abuse involves improper food storage temps/times—neither applies here. Thus, the correct answer is A.
